引言
随着无线网络技术的普及,WiFi已经成为我们日常生活中不可或缺的一部分。然而,对于一些公共WiFi或家庭WiFi,密码保护成为了一个难题。本文将探讨如何利用前端WebSocket技术轻松实现无线连接,破解WiFi密码。
前端WebSocket简介
WebSocket是一种在单个TCP连接上进行全双工通信的协议。它允许服务器和客户端之间进行实时数据交换,无需轮询或长轮询等传统方法。在实现无线连接方面,WebSocket可以作为一种有效的手段。
实现步骤
1. 准备工作
首先,确保你的设备已经连接到目标WiFi网络。然后,打开你的浏览器,访问以下网址:
ws://[WiFi名称]:[WiFi密码]
这里的[WiFi名称]和[WiFi密码]分别替换为你的WiFi名称和密码。
2. 连接WebSocket
在浏览器中,使用JavaScript代码连接到WebSocket服务器:
var socket = new WebSocket("ws://[WiFi名称]:[WiFi密码]");
3. 发送数据
连接成功后,你可以向服务器发送数据,请求破解WiFi密码。以下是一个示例:
socket.send("破解WiFi密码");
4. 接收数据
服务器接收到请求后,会返回破解后的WiFi密码。你可以通过监听onmessage事件来获取数据:
socket.onmessage = function(event) {
var password = event.data;
console.log("破解后的WiFi密码为:" + password);
};
注意事项
- 安全性:使用WebSocket破解WiFi密码存在一定的风险,请确保你的设备安全,避免被恶意攻击。
- 合法性:破解WiFi密码可能涉及违法行为,请遵守当地法律法规。
- 技术限制:WebSocket协议并不直接支持破解WiFi密码,本文仅为一种技术探讨。
总结
本文介绍了如何利用前端WebSocket技术实现无线连接,破解WiFi密码。虽然这种方法存在一定的风险和限制,但可以作为技术探讨的一种思路。在实际应用中,请确保遵守法律法规,保护网络安全。
